A casual handwritten print with a consistent rightward slant and brush-like stroke modulation. Letterforms are narrow and compact, with rounded terminals and slightly tapered ends that suggest a quick marker or brush pen. Strokes show medium contrast from pressure changes, and the overall rhythm is bouncy, with subtly uneven widths and a naturally varied baseline/spacing that keeps the texture organic while remaining legible.
Best suited to short-to-medium display settings such as headlines, pull quotes, posters, packaging accents, and social media graphics where an approachable handmade feel is desired. It can also work for casual invitations or card fronts, while longer passages may benefit from generous size and spacing to preserve clarity.
The tone feels informal and personable, like fast but confident note-taking or a friendly headline on a poster. Its lively slant and brisk curves add momentum, giving text an upbeat, conversational character rather than a formal or quiet one.
The design appears intended to capture an easy, everyday handwritten look with the clarity of unconnected letters, balancing spontaneity with enough regularity to function reliably in display typography.
Caps are simple and open, avoiding elaborate loops, while many lowercase forms are single-storey and streamlined, reinforcing the quick handwritten impression. Numerals follow the same slanted, brushy logic and read clearly at display sizes.
